- Home
> - Iowa
> - Cedar Rapids
Richmonds Automaxx Inc Reviews
2029 16th Avenue Southwest,
Cedar Rapids, IA - 52404
319-247-2886
Here you Post and Read Genuine reviews about Richmonds Automaxx Inc Cedar Rapids Iowa 52404 from real Customers. Clients / buyers are Posting the original reviews and their experience while dealing at Richmonds Automaxx Inc's dealership in Iowa - 52404.